OFA provided a written submission to ERO # 025-0450, ERO # 025-0504, and ORR # 25-MTO005 on proposed amendments related to transit and infrastructure under schedules 2 and 8 of Bill 17, Protect Ontario by Building Faster and Smarter Act, 2025.
OFA comments that fast, frequent, and efficient public transportation solutions would help to direct municipalities towards developing inwards and upwards. OFA cautions, however, that railways and other linear infrastructure that cut across the countryside may cause disruptions for farmers and rural communities. If transit companies, such as Metrolinx, propose new or expanding infrastructure in rural Ontario, they must avoid causing harm to farms and rural properties by first consulting with farmers. Transit companies must fulfill their duties under the Drainage Act and provide crossings such that farmers can continue to make use of their entire property.
